Output d64e37482ea3dcbb20ce8646b8e0b21157297735b55f150308c1ea6bba00a3be:5

value
5500000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 864285056702bff61f381bc2c5e78e201e827ea5 OP_EQUAL
address
3DvvA7VmKNEmdUK2PVX3aTGhG1NGVsFHL5
transaction
d64e37482ea3dcbb20ce8646b8e0b21157297735b55f150308c1ea6bba00a3be
spent
true